Pros and Cons

Black Diamond Spot 400 Headlamp

Pros:
  • Versatile lighting modes (spot, flood, strobe, red light)
  • Comfortable and well-balanced design
  • Secure fit with adjustable headband
  • Easy to operate with gloves
  • Impressive burn times on low mode
Cons:
  • Battery life may vary from advertised specifications
  • Adjusting straps can be challenging with thick winter gloves

REI Co-op Half Dome 2 Plus Tent

Pros:
  • Good ventilation due to large vents and mesh design
  • Easy to adjust rainfly in adverse weather
  • Sturdy construction
  • Full-coverage rainfly
  • Raised bathtub floor with quality seam taping
  • Handles most 3-season conditions
  • Survived a 1-hour heavy rain test without leaking
Cons:
  • Fairly large packed size
  • Some find it tough to pack down into its stuff sack
  • May need better quality stakes and additional cord for windy conditions
